Transaction 6597755dda46651583f57746507939c91203dba653663418a4b9051d65f89a8b

1 Input
2 Outputs
  • 6597755dda46651583f57746507939c91203dba653663418a4b9051d65f89a8b:0
  • value  1425112
    address  36TXdE4C4gfnRPqFLiQ2gkDnMGy2vTPxZw
  • 6597755dda46651583f57746507939c91203dba653663418a4b9051d65f89a8b:1
  • value  1000000
    address  1BKdFovmTVe46ai5peHL8HXjm5oa8NZMUp